At Nucraft Furniture Company, Rob shares that they really wanted to transform their culture. First starting with what our desired culture must be to achieve the desired 27% growth over three years and then went to the people. By conducting a cultural assessment or our associates we armed ourselves with the data needed to set short term-plans for improvement.

Interestingly, we have figure out a connection to these behaviors to our bottom line financial growth, which as the behaviors improve so does our organizations KPIs. This has provided two record quarters back-to-back. Imagine everyone engaging in an organization and with each layer striving for the desired behaviors which collectively equate to company growth and success.

It becomes a great place to work when you focus on respect for every individual, as one example, and the output is company growth.
